The DNG (Digital Negative) format is a royalty-free file format for raw images developed by Adobe. It serves as a universal standard that preserves the integrity of original raw images while allowing for easy editing and archiving. By supporting DNG, photographers ensure compatibility with a wide range of software and equipment, enhancing workflow efficiency and image preservation.
XWD, or X Window Dump, is a bitmap file format used for capturing screenshots in the X Window System. It stores image data in a raw format along with metadata, making it ideal for developers and graphic designers working on Linux and UNIX platforms. XWD files can be converted to more common formats, ensuring compatibility with various applications and enhancing workflow efficiency.
